  5. ihawkeyes's Avatar
    I would, but I can't get to a menu! lol. When i hit the BB buton I only get Exit or something else...can't remember what it is off the top of my head.
    go to options>depending on what os system you have, find applications>highlight google maps>bb button>disable compatability mode.
    hope this helps.

  19. kcarpenter9503's Avatar
    What about the email Issue I have the same problem
    I think i figured this one out...kind of forgot about having the issue till i just went to send an email.

    After you type the email address make sure your press enter. It should give you another place for TO:

    the try to send it.
